5 Days Safari Uganda and Rwanda will first take you to Uganda’s Bwindi impenetrable national park, the prime home for almost three quarters of the world’s total remaining population of the mountain gorillas. Here you will track the mighty apes in the forest, spend an hour with them and also visit the famous Batwa pygmies of the forest.
The five days then take you to Volcanoes national park in Rwanda; the land of a thousand hills. Here you are to track the golden monkeys and also visit the popular Ibyiwachu cultural village that displays all the three Rwanda’s Ethnic groups in one center.

Day 1: Transfer from Kampala to Bwindi impenetrable national park.
Early morning, be picked by the company driver guide from the airport or the lodge where you would have spent the previous night. Enjoy a comfortable drive from Kampala to Bwindi, it’s approximately an eight hour drive taking almost a full day.
The journey itself is an experience of its own on the trip. Have a stop at the equator line in Kayabwe and watch the water experiment that shows that water flows to different directions in the different hemispheres. Then proceed to Igongo cultural Centre in Mbarara for a lunch stop over.
After lunch, continue directly to Bwindi impenetrable park enjoying the beautiful moments of viewing the extremely striking landscapes, some plain plateaus and others valleys rolled in Kigezi hills, tinted with the green vegetation.

Day 2: Gorilla trekking and Batwa community.
Have an early morning breakfast and head to the park headquarters for a short briefing from the park ranger about the rules and regulations of gorilla trekking and also be grouped.
Start the trek in the jungle to hunt for the mountain gorillas. The trek is quite hectic as it involves a simple hike into the forest and starts as early as 7:30am. Walk in the impenetrable forest, paving your way out with a hand stick till you finally meet the gentle apes. Spend the magical hour with the gorillas, taking photos, watching them play with each other and conducting their normal lives.
Looking straight in the red eyes of a silverback a lifetime memory. After the hour trek back to the lodge for lunch and refreshments and then go for a cultural encounter with the Batwa forest people, the ones believed to be the first inhabitants of the forest. Explore their day to day lives and also taste their local cuisines.

Day 4: Golden monkey trekking and Ibyiwachu cultural village.
In the morning after an early breakfast, head to the park headquarters for a short briefing from the park guide and then enter the forest for the golden monkey trekking. Just in a few minutes, meet the beautiful golden monkeys and watch them play and jump from one tree branch to another and see how the live daily. It’s simply an experience for life.
Later on after lunch, visit the famous Ibyiwachu cultural village that gathers together all the three ethnic groups of Rwanda in only one stop point. Engage in the traditional dances performed here. A taste of the local cuisine is a guarantee except to those that don’t want.
